首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在SAS中循环以带来最新值

在SAS中,循环是一种重复执行特定任务的控制结构。循环的目的是为了在每次迭代中更新变量的值,以便在每次迭代中使用最新的值。

在SAS中,有多种循环语句可供使用,包括DO循环、DO WHILE循环和DO UNTIL循环。这些循环语句可以根据条件来控制循环的执行次数。

  1. DO循环:DO循环是最常用的循环语句之一。它允许您指定循环的开始值、结束值和递增步长。例如,以下代码演示了一个简单的DO循环,从1循环到10,并在每次迭代中打印变量i的值:
代码语言:txt
复制
data example;
   do i = 1 to 10;
      put i;
   end;
run;

在这个例子中,变量i的值在每次迭代中都会更新,并且在每次迭代中都会打印出来。

  1. DO WHILE循环:DO WHILE循环是在每次迭代之前检查条件的循环。只有在条件为真时,循环才会执行。例如,以下代码演示了一个DO WHILE循环,从1开始,每次迭代将变量i的值加倍,直到i的值大于100:
代码语言:txt
复制
data example;
   i = 1;
   do while (i <= 100);
      put i;
      i = i * 2;
   end;
run;

在这个例子中,变量i的值在每次迭代中都会更新,并且只有在i的值小于或等于100时,循环才会执行。

  1. DO UNTIL循环:DO UNTIL循环是在每次迭代之后检查条件的循环。只有在条件为假时,循环才会执行。例如,以下代码演示了一个DO UNTIL循环,从1开始,每次迭代将变量i的值加1,直到i的值大于10:
代码语言:txt
复制
data example;
   i = 1;
   do until (i > 10);
      put i;
      i = i + 1;
   end;
run;

在这个例子中,变量i的值在每次迭代中都会更新,并且只有在i的值大于10时,循环才会结束。

总结:循环在SAS中是一种重复执行任务的控制结构。通过使用不同类型的循环语句,可以根据条件来控制循环的执行次数。循环可以用于各种任务,例如数据处理、统计分析和模型建立等。

对于SAS中循环的更多详细信息和用法,请参考腾讯云的SAS产品文档:SAS产品文档

请注意,以上答案仅供参考,具体的循环使用方法可能因实际情况而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券